Life Groups


CHRISTIANITY IS A TEAM SPORT.

While we often speak of our "personal" relationship with God, we must not ignore the necessity of our "corporate" relationship with God. Although that phrase may sound strange, the Bible is clear that much of what the Lord longs to give to His people only comes through the avenue of relationship with other believers. God intentionally created us to be interdependent.

THAT INTERDEPENDENCE CANNOT BE FOSTERED IN A CHURCH SERVICE. 

This is why Heartland has Life Groups. The groups are patterned after the Acts 2 model used by the early church: "The believers devoted themselves to the apostle's teaching, fellowship, the breaking of bread, and prayer." Life Groups consist of 10-15 people who meet in a host home for food, fellowship, teaching, discussion and prayer.
